|
|
|
Текущая дата
|
|||
|---|---|---|---|
|
#18+
4m@t!cГоворится о том, что числовой контекст это строка например "19990213". где 02 воспринимается, как месяц.Возможно. Действительно, не проверял. Никогда не было в этом необходимости. Помимо прочего - у timestamp'а слишком малая ОДЗ.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 17.02.2006, 15:40:35 |
|
||
|
Текущая дата
|
|||
|---|---|---|---|
|
#18+
vivу тебя есть поле в таблице типа интегер ты вставляешь туда текущую дату mktime(0, 0, 0, date("m", time()), date("d", time()), date("Y", time())) тоесть даже если сейчас высокосный год, то все равно у тебя идет отсчет от 1го января 1970 года в секундах и если тебе нужно сделать выборку в промежутке ты берешь первую дату one_data = mktime(0, 0, 0, 1, 1, 2005); потом берешь вторую дату two_data = mktime(0, 0, 0, 1, 1, 2006) получаешь нужный период строешь запрос select * mytable WHERE my_field_data >= one_data AND my_field_data <= two_data и нет никакой проблемы с высокосным не высокосным годамиМужик. Ты не в теме. Такую белиберду делать надо средствами базы, а не клиента. Кроме того то, что ты привёл - ерунда - ибо просили выбрать тех, кто родился в феврале, а не тех, кто родился в феврале 2005го года. Про то, что существует преогромное множество людей, родившихся до 1970го (вы ведь под виндой работаете)/1901го года, я помолчу.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 17.02.2006, 15:44:55 |
|
||
|
Текущая дата
|
|||
|---|---|---|---|
|
#18+
*Мужик. Ты не в теме. Такую белиберду делать надо средствами базы, а не клиента. Кроме того то, что ты привёл - ерунда - ибо просили выбрать тех, кто родился в феврале, а не тех, кто родился в феврале 2005го года. Про то, что существует преогромное множество людей, родившихся до 1970го (вы ведь под виндой работаете)/1901го года, я помолчу. он писал что вписывает текущие даты в поля. А не дни рождения Зои космедемьнской по григорианскому календарю. Я например работал вот с таким вариантом записи дат в проектах сдачи в оренду всякого жилья где нужны были периоды. И это было гараздо удобнее чем маятся с типом дата.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 17.02.2006, 23:56:01 |
|
||
|
Текущая дата
|
|||
|---|---|---|---|
|
#18+
А что с ним "маяться"-то??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 18.02.2006, 00:13:03 |
|
||
|
Текущая дата
|
|||
|---|---|---|---|
|
#18+
vivИ это было гараздо удобнее чем маятся с типом дата.Если вы не умеете готовить, это ещё не значит, что причина в том, что вам дали плохую поварённую книгу.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 18.02.2006, 00:48:55 |
|
||
|
Текущая дата
|
|||
|---|---|---|---|
|
#18+
viv, ответьте на вопросы: 1. Зачем хранить дату заключения договора с точностью до секунды? 2. Вы считаете, что удобней делать выборку за отчетный период, при этом каждый раз переводить юникс время в человеческое??? ---------------------------------------- Артисты не приехали, приехали цыгане 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 18.02.2006, 12:56:36 |
|
||
|
|

start [/forum/topic.php?fid=23&gotonew=1&tid=1476718]: |
0ms |
get settings: |
8ms |
get forum list: |
14ms |
check forum access: |
3ms |
check topic access: |
3ms |
track hit: |
19ms |
get topic data: |
8ms |
get first new msg: |
5ms |
get forum data: |
2ms |
get page messages: |
39ms |
get tp. blocked users: |
2ms |
| others: | 197ms |
| total: | 300ms |

| 0 / 0 |
